Receive() - The socket is marked as nonblocking and the receive operation would block"
当非阻塞(异步)套接字试图执行无法立即执行的操作时,将返回错误10035。此错误并不致命,应用程序应将其视为建议。此错误代码对应于Windows套接字错误WSAEWOULDBLOCK。当从非阻塞套接字读
我有一个长期运行的(简化的)查询,如下所示: FOR i in (SELECT * FROM T WHERE ....) DMBS_OUTPUT.PUT_LINE(i.VALUE);END;当我执行它时,由于大的表和复杂的条件,它需要几个小时,并且我的sqldeveloper在该会话上基本上是冻结的。无法创建新连接,必须打开新的sqldeveloper实例。
有没有什么办法不阻止它呢?就像在后台运行,但仍然输出到控制台/文件?我知道我可以创建SQL脚本并从命令行界面运行,但我想知道sqldeveloper本身是否有任何解决方